    摘要:

    目的:探讨眼部蠕形螨感染影响睑酯菌群组成的相关分析。

    方法:采用非干预性、观察性研究的方法,选取2020-07/2021-02我院39例受试者,根据有无蠕形螨感染或有无睑板腺功能障碍(MGD)将受试者分为三组,对照组(14例)、睑板腺功能障碍组(MGD组,14组)、蠕形螨感染组(FM组,11组)。对三组受试者睑板腺睑酯样本进行16S rRNA基因V3~V4片段的高通量测序,测序数据进行生物信息学分析,以研究眼部蠕形螨受试者睑酯菌群的构成及差异。

    结果:蠕形螨感染组的假单胞菌属和丛毛单胞菌属丰度均显著高于健康对照组和MGD组(P<0.05),罗尔斯通氏菌属丰度显著低于对照组和MGD组(P<0.05)。MGD组和FM组睑酯菌群微生物丰富度、微生物群落多样性显著高于健康对照组(P<0.05)。

    结论:蠕形螨感染改变了睑酯菌群的构成,并提高了睑酯菌群的微生物丰富度和群落多样性。

    Abstract:

    AIM: To investigate the correlation between the ocular demodex infection and the composition of meibum lipid flora.

    METHODS: A non-interventional and observational study was performed on recruited 39 patients in our hospital between July 2020 and February 2021. They were divided into control group(n=14), meibomian gland dysfunction(MGD)group(n=14), and demodex group(FM, n=11)according to the presence or absence of demodex infection or MGD. High-throughput sequencing of V3-V4 fragment of 16S rRNA gene was performed on the meibomian ester samples of the three groups of subjects, and bioinformatics analysis was performed on the sequencing data to study the composition and difference of meibum lipid flora in the subjects of ocular demodex.

    RESULTS: Pseudomonas and Comamonas in FM group were significantly higher than those in control group and MGD group(P<0.05), while Ralstonia in Demodex infection group was significantly lower than that in control group and MGD group(P<0.05). The microbial richness and community diversity of meibum lipid flora of the MGD group and the FM group were significantly higher than those of the control group(P<0.05).

    CONCLUSION: Ocular demodex infection changed the composition of meibum lipid flora and increased the microbial richness and community diversity of meibum lipid flora.
